Output eef45fba91d2b9b08f770cd578f4bca26d45d2a8eed50c8c06cc284fb1be7214:0

value
3688766
script pubkey
OP_0 OP_PUSHBYTES_20 58dae7810d6e23106c7bcb133b162f7a1fcbca0d
address
bc1qtrdw0qgddc33qmrmevfnk9300g0uhjsdyactcu
transaction
eef45fba91d2b9b08f770cd578f4bca26d45d2a8eed50c8c06cc284fb1be7214